Transaction b8993d092f48889115c2500052b7aa23a693341a7f4436b6db2c2a822971aea4
3 Input
1 Outputs
- b8993d092f48889115c2500052b7aa23a693341a7f4436b6db2c2a822971aea4:0
value 1568123
address 3EWKLf361T8obF8m9weq1Ha9gAWkbPogbC